S is well known, one of the triumphs of classical physics was the unraveling of the phenomenon of Brownian motion by Einstein and von Smoluchowski. Out of these early investigations of Einstein and von Smoluchowski an extensive literature on the theory of probability and random variables has grown. In this paper we shall not attempt to summarize these varied developments; we shall limit ourselves, rather, to an analysis of the physical (as distinct from the mathematical) foundations of the theory and to an illustration from stellar dynamics how Einstein's ideas have found fruitful applications in a very diferent Geld.As for the part A (t) the following principal assumptions are made:(i) A (t) is independent of u,'and (ii) A (t) varies extremely rapidly compared with u. The second of these assumptionsimplies that time intervals At exist such that during ht the changes in u to be expected are very small, while during the same interval A (t) may undergo a very large number of Quctuations. Alternatively, we may express this assumption by the state-ment that though u (t) and u (t+ At) areexpected to differ by a negligible amount, no correlation between A (t) and A (t+ Dt) is expected.
